Log:
- Introduce the client_pinfo() KPI in order to print informations in the
infofile.
- Adjust/Modify comments about error handling in the specific
functions.
TODO:
Better handle the free_client() callings, specify a correct semantic,
auditing the callers and verify nothing breaks.
